Burglary and Arrest Details

James Wall, a 20-year-old from Beverston Gardens in Bristol, was sentenced to two years in prison for burglary after stealing luxury items from a home in Southborough, Tunbridge Wells, on December 13, 2025. The items included four Gucci and Cartier watches, a diamond ring, and foreign currency. Wall's criminal activities were brought to an end when he was recognized by police due to his distinctive bright neon T-shirt while he was eating at a chip shop in Bexley.

The burglary occurred around 5:45 PM, and Wall was reported to have verbally abused a witness who questioned his presence in the area. He fled the scene in a silver Vauxhall Insignia, which was later pursued by police. The vehicle was spotted traveling at speeds nearing 100 mph on the M25 before being stopped near Wilmington, where Wall attempted to drive the wrong way on the carriageway. A 38-year-old man was arrested at the scene for driving offenses but was released pending further investigation.

High-Speed Pursuit and Capture

Following the car chase, Wall abandoned the vehicle and was tracked down by a police dog handler. He was found in the chip shop, where he was apprehended while consuming fish and chips and waiting for staff to charge his phone. The police seized his phone, and digital forensic analysis confirmed his presence at the burglary scene. Additionally, officers recovered two jewellery boxes, two false vehicle registration plates, and a jewellery-cleaning cloth from the abandoned car.

Official Statements and Responses

Detective Constable Celia King, who was involved in the investigation, noted that Wall initially refused to accept responsibility for the burglary and laughed while viewing footage of the police pursuit. The judge considered the planning involved in the burglary when sentencing Wall to an immediate custodial sentence.
